Pneumonia: Causes, Symptoms, and Treatment Pneumonia, a prevalent and potentially severe respiratory infection, can impact individuals of all ages, especially those with compromised immune systems or underlying health conditions. Recognizing its causes, identifying symptoms, and seeking timely medical attention is crucial for effective management. Let’s delve into the details of this condition: What is Pneumonia? Pneumonia is an infection that inflames air sacs in one or both lungs, causing them to fill with fluid or pus. The common cold is a viral infection affecting the upper respiratory tract. It’s highly contagious and can cause discomfort with symptoms like a runny or stuffy nose, sore throat, coughing, sneezing, and sometimes a mild fever. While not as severe as the flu, the common cold can still disrupt daily activities. Here’s how to find relief from its symptoms and prevent its spread. The flu, short for influenza, is a contagious respiratory illness caused by influenza viruses that infect the nose, throat, and sometimes the lungs. Each year, millions of people worldwide are affected by the flu, leading to a range of symptoms from mild to severe. Understanding the symptoms, preventive measures, and treatment options is essential in managing this common yet potentially serious illness.
